A red sky this morning, that sailor's warning.  Dull and windy most of the day, cooler and rain this evening. 

Arrived at work, headed out on the south essykert with Jack driving and Lewis a loader with me.  Black bag bin day around Tingwall, Girlsta, Stromfirth, Whiteness and Weisdale.  Saw an otter this morning, and plenty of mice in the bin boxes.  Walkies with Sammy after work, popped by Madeline's for a cuppa.  A quiet evening at home with the telly. 

That fine spell of weather was lovely, knew it wouldn't last forever, and we escaped with a fairly fine day for work today.  The trees definitely have that autumnal look, leaves are turning brown and falling fast.  Gales meant to come in next week, that'll probably cleared the most of the remaining leaves.  Looking over the Nethersound area, in the Cott Road, Weisdale.
